Windstorm II: Everyone Knows It's Windy
The sequel is rarely as good as the original, but Spokane expects
another big windstorm today, KREM says. The winds will be 10 to 15 miles an hour less than last time, but since the soil is so waterlogged and the tree roots are already weakened, it could cause more trees to fall.

Unpaid Leave
The Spokane Police Guild president has officially been placed on unpaid leave after allegedly leaking the news of a search warrant to an officer suspected of raping a female officer, the
Spokesman-Review says.
